Symptoms

  • •Infotainment screen becomes unresponsive
  • •System restarts intermittently
  • •Navigation features fail to load or function properly
  • •Bluetooth connectivity issues with devices
  • •Error messages displayed on the screen
  • •Touchscreen delays in response

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ather tools and parts needed for the repair.
  • Ensure the vehicle is parked on a level surface with the engine off.
  • Disconnect the negative battery terminal to prevent electrical shorts.
2. Update the Software
  • Required Tools: Laptop with internet access, USB drive.
  • Visit the official Toyota website to check for the latest infotainment software updates.
  • Download the update onto a USB drive following the manufacturer’s instructions.
  • Insert the USB drive into the vehicle's USB port and follow on-screen prompts to install the update.
3. Reset the System
  • Required Tools: None.
  • Reconnect the negative battery terminal.
  • Start the vehicle and allow the infotainment system to power up.
  • Perform a soft reset by holding down the power button on the infotainment display for approximately 10 seconds until the system reboots.
4. Inspect Wiring Connections
  • Required Tools: Screwdriver set, flashlight.
  • Remove the trim panel surrounding the infotainment unit using a screwdriver.
  • Inspect all wiring harnesses and connectors for signs of damage or corrosion.
  • Ensure all connections are secure and reassemble the trim panel.
5. Battery Voltage Check
  • Required Tools: Multimeter.
  • With the vehicle on, measure the battery voltage. It should read between 12.6 to 14.4 volts.
  • If voltage is low, consider a battery replacement or check for parasitic drains.
